How to Identify Reliable Car Shipping Companies in Your Area

Selecting a dependable vehicle shipping company is essential when you are transporting a car across great distances to guarantee it arrives on time, without extra fees, and safe. This is a thorough manual on spotting trustworthy car shipping businesses near you:

1. Research initially

Start your research by going through online reviews and ratings on sites such Google, Yelp, and Better Business Bureau (BBB). Seek businesses with many good ratings and observe how they address grievances. Recommendations: Consult friends, relatives, or coworkers who have had car shipping experience. Personal advice may help to shed light on something never seen on internet.

2. Validate

By consulting the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), verify that the business has a license. Every reputable auto shipping business ought to display a Motor Carrier (MC) number and a USDOT number.

Insurance: Check their insurance policy. A trustworthy carrier will have insurance that protects items throughout shipment. Ask to review the insurance policy so you can grasp what is included.

3. Level of experience and expertise

Experience in the field: More trustworthy are businesses in existence for several years. They appreciate the subtleties of securely shipping cars over different paths.

Specialization: Some businesses focus on the transportation of particular kinds of cars, including luxury or vintage ones, Seek for a firm with experience in the field if you have particular demands.

4. Number of Services

See if the business provides open and enclosed transport choices. Though more costly, enclosed shipping offers better vehicle security.

Geographical Reach: Verify the company includes both the delivery and pickup points. Some companies could need extra accommodations, especially if they will not service particular locations.

5. Cost and Conditions of Payment

Dependable businesses will provide a straightforward and thorough price quotation that covers all costs, even possible extra charges. Stay away from businesses with big upfront payments or undisclosed charges.

A reputable business will present trusted payment methods. Companies asking only for cash should be approached with caution.

6. Customer support

Evaluate their customer service starting from their first contact. A trustworthy business will assist you first and provide knowledge. They ought to give you a contact person who will keep you informed all along the shipment.

Customization: Specific requests or worries should not be a problem with the business. This might mean handling unique directions for your car or providing flexible pickup and delivery times.

7. Careful reading of the agreement is needed

Read any document carefully before signing any agreement; Notice delivery times, insurance information, and cancellation rules. Ensure no disadvantageous clauses exist.

Dispute Handling: Observe the company’s approach to resolving conflicts. A good decision mechanism shows the company’s confidence in customer satisfaction and service level.

8. Caution signals to be on the lookout for

Lowball Offers: If a quote is significantly lower than market rates, it might be a sign of a scam or a company that cuts corners.

Avoid a no contract business. In case of contentious, the agreement helps to protect both sides.

Poor communication or trouble obtaining direct answers from a business can suggest future issues.

Conclusion:

To find a trustworthy car shipping firm one needs to conduct thorough investigation and give much thought to several elements, from legitimacy and experience to customer service and clear pricing. Evaluating every possible business will help guarantee your car is in good hands and help to simplify the transportation process. Remember, with regard to the safety and security of your vehicle, the least expensive option may not always be the best choice.
